在日常生活中,我们经常会遇到各种突发的小概率事件,如自然灾害、交通事故、疾病爆发等。这些事件虽然发生的概率较低,但一旦发生,往往会对社会造成严重影响。因此,如何精准估算这些突发小概率事件的发生概率,成为了一个重要的科学问题。本文将揭秘科学预测背后的秘密,探讨如何进行精准估算。
一、概率论基础
要估算突发小概率事件,首先需要了解概率论的基本概念。概率论是一门研究随机现象的数学分支,它通过概率来描述随机事件发生的可能性。在概率论中,事件的发生概率可以用以下公式表示:
[ P(A) = \frac{\text{事件A发生的次数}}{\text{所有可能发生的次数}} ]
其中,( P(A) ) 表示事件A发生的概率。
二、历史数据分析
估算突发小概率事件的发生概率,可以通过历史数据分析来进行。通过对历史数据的分析,我们可以找出事件发生的规律,从而预测未来事件发生的可能性。
1. 数据收集
首先,需要收集与事件相关的历史数据。例如,对于地震事件,需要收集地震发生的地点、时间、震级等数据。
2. 数据处理
收集到数据后,需要进行处理,包括数据清洗、数据整合等。数据清洗的目的是去除错误数据、异常数据等,保证数据的准确性。
3. 数据分析
在数据处理完成后,可以进行数据分析。常用的数据分析方法包括:
- 描述性统计:描述数据的基本特征,如平均值、方差等。
- 相关性分析:分析不同变量之间的关系。
- 时间序列分析:分析事件发生的规律,如周期性、趋势性等。
三、模型构建
在历史数据分析的基础上,可以构建预测模型。预测模型分为以下几种:
1. 经验模型
经验模型基于历史数据,通过统计分析方法构建。常见的经验模型包括:
- 线性回归模型:通过线性关系描述事件发生的概率。
- 逻辑回归模型:通过非线性关系描述事件发生的概率。
2. 机器学习模型
机器学习模型通过学习历史数据,自动提取特征,从而预测事件发生的概率。常见的机器学习模型包括:
- 决策树:通过树状结构描述事件发生的概率。
- 支持向量机:通过寻找最优的超平面来预测事件发生的概率。
3. 深度学习模型
深度学习模型通过多层神经网络模拟人脑的感知和认知过程,从而预测事件发生的概率。常见的深度学习模型包括:
- 卷积神经网络:适用于图像数据。
- 循环神经网络:适用于序列数据。
四、模型评估与优化
构建预测模型后,需要进行评估和优化。模型评估常用的指标包括:
- 准确率:预测正确的比例。
- 召回率:预测为正例的真实正例比例。
- F1值:准确率和召回率的调和平均值。
模型优化可以通过以下方法进行:
- 参数调整:调整模型参数,提高模型的预测能力。
- 特征选择:选择对事件发生概率有较大影响的特征。
- 模型融合:结合多个模型,提高预测的准确性。
五、案例分析
以下是一个关于地震预测的案例分析:
1. 数据收集
收集了某地区过去100年的地震数据,包括地震发生的时间、地点、震级等。
2. 数据处理
对收集到的数据进行清洗,去除错误数据、异常数据等。
3. 数据分析
通过描述性统计、相关性分析等方法,发现地震发生的时间、地点、震级等特征之间存在一定的规律。
4. 模型构建
选择决策树模型进行预测,通过调整模型参数,提高预测的准确性。
5. 模型评估与优化
使用测试数据对模型进行评估,发现模型的准确率为80%。通过参数调整、特征选择等方法,将模型的准确率提高到90%。
六、总结
精准估算突发小概率事件的发生概率,对于防灾减灾具有重要意义。通过历史数据分析、模型构建、模型评估与优化等步骤,可以实现对突发小概率事件的精准预测。然而,预测结果并非绝对准确,仍需结合实际情况进行判断。随着科学技术的不断发展,相信未来在突发小概率事件预测方面将取得更大的突破。
